Transaction 03494950fe2b7d346e1bbd85868163cd2f9689260379daf224933f3628e2f645

1 Input
2 Outputs
  • 03494950fe2b7d346e1bbd85868163cd2f9689260379daf224933f3628e2f645:0
  • value  19746240
    address  3DEfirNcNLSXA1Qik8B6RYCthxHmMXL34i
  • 03494950fe2b7d346e1bbd85868163cd2f9689260379daf224933f3628e2f645:1
  • value  3561927206
    address  14Q8uYuCSDHLYNByKDyZshVBpW4bZDyipQ